Yeah like others have said stall. One other thing to mention is you aren't getting many calories so cardio may be hurting at this point. If your body senses you aren't getting calories and you are active it'll start shutting stuff down to preserve energy and you will stall even at low calorie counts.
In other words stalls are more likely to be "Oh shit I'm starving let's save energy" than you eating more calories than you are burning. Most post op workouts are just centered around preserving and building muscle mass and being non sedentary by walking. Heavy cardio is typically discouraged, and some of our docs, mine included, banned us from doing it.
